Ola Elazazy is a scholar working on Molecular Biology, Cancer Research and Surgery. According to data from OpenAlex, Ola Elazazy has authored 18 papers receiving a total of 412 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Molecular Biology, 11 papers in Cancer Research and 3 papers in Surgery. Recurrent topics in Ola Elazazy's work include MicroRNA in disease regulation (7 papers), Circular RNAs in diseases (5 papers) and Cancer-related molecular mechanisms research (4 papers). Ola Elazazy is often cited by papers focused on MicroRNA in disease regulation (7 papers), Circular RNAs in diseases (5 papers) and Cancer-related molecular mechanisms research (4 papers). Ola Elazazy collaborates with scholars based in Egypt, Saudi Arabia and Oman. Ola Elazazy's co-authors include Mohammed S. Elballal, Mahmoud A. Elrebehy, Ahmed S. Doghish, Ahmed E. Elesawy, Heba M. Midan, Reem K. Shahin, Al-Aliaa M. Sallam, Abdullah M. M. Elbadry, Khalda Amr and Sherif S. Abdel Mageed and has published in prestigious journals such as Life Sciences, Toxicology and Applied Pharmacology and Archives of Oral Biology.
